Cygwin services store the Win32 paths to the executables -- thus, moving
Cygwin to another drive requires a reinstall of each service.

FWIW, something like the below should work to remove all services:

	cygrunsrv -L | xargs -rn1 cygrunsrv -E
	cygrunsrv -L | xargs -rn1 cygrunsrv -R
